[發明專利]嵌入式系統中的快速人臉檢測方法有效
| 申請號: | 201810388775.9 | 申請日: | 2018-04-26 |
| 公開(公告)號: | CN109614841B | 公開(公告)日: | 2023-04-18 |
| 發明(設計)人: | 劉玉宇;王增鍬 | 申請(專利權)人: | 杭州智諾科技股份有限公司 |
| 主分類號: | G06V40/16 | 分類號: | G06V40/16 |
| 代理公司: | 杭州杭誠專利事務所有限公司 33109 | 代理人: | 閻忠華 |
| 地址: | 311100 浙江省杭州*** | 國省代碼: | 浙江;33 |
| 權利要求書: | 查看更多 | 說明書: | 查看更多 |
| 摘要: | |||
| 搜索關鍵詞: | 嵌入式 系統 中的 快速 檢測 方法 | ||
1.一種嵌入式系統中的快速人臉檢測方法,其特征是,包括如下步驟:
嵌入式系統提供高分辨率視頻數據流和低分辨率視頻數據流;
(1-1)對低分辨率視頻數據流的當前時刻幀進行運動檢測;
利用如下公式進行運動檢測;
M0(x′,y′)為當前時刻幀的運動檢測結果圖像,I0(x′,y′)為低分辨率視頻數據流的當前時刻幀的灰度圖像,I-1(x′,y′)為低分辨率視頻數據流的前一時刻幀幀的灰度圖像,x′和y′為低分辨率視頻數據流的灰度圖像的橫坐標和縱坐標,T1為運動檢測判別閾值;
(1-2)利用高分辨率的視頻數據流的當前時刻幀進行子圖人臉檢測;
包括如下步驟:
(2-1)對高分辨率的視頻數據流中的當前時刻幀圖像截取用戶檢測區域圖像,將用戶檢測區域圖像進行l次降采樣后的圖像的坐標(xl,yl)轉換為低分辨率的運動檢測結果圖像的對應坐標(x',y');
其中,l為用戶檢測區域圖像降采樣的次數,s為對用戶檢測區域圖像降采樣的倍率,xd和yd為用戶檢測區域圖像的左上角橫坐標和縱坐標,wf和hf為人臉檢測模板的寬和高,rw和rh為高分辨率圖像與低分辨率圖像在橫向和縱向的像素數比值;
(2-2)以降采樣后的有運動的用戶檢測區域圖像的每個像素點的坐標(xl,yl)為中心,摳取寬度為wf和高度為hf的子圖x;
(2-3)僅對判斷有運動的子圖計算是否存在人臉,無運動的子圖直接判為不存在人臉;判斷方式為,根據坐標變化得到的低分辨率圖像坐標(x',y'),若低分辨率圖像坐標(x',y')處的M0(x',y')=1,則判斷為子圖存在運動;若為0,則判斷子圖無運動;
(2-4)計算通過訓練得到的N個弱分類器hk(x)的輸出值,弱分類器hk(x)的輸出值為0或為1;
若判定子圖x內有人臉;
(1-3)將有人臉的各個子圖的中心位置坐標添加到結果列表中;
(1-4)融合結果列表中的重疊檢測結果。
2.根據權利要求1所述的嵌入式系統中的快速人臉檢測方法,其特征是,步驟(1-3)包括如下步驟:
將有人臉的子圖x的中心位置坐標(xl,yl)添加到結果列表中,設i,j為結果列表中的任意兩個檢測結果的序號,i不等于j。
3.根據權利要求1或2所述的嵌入式系統中的快速人臉檢測方法,其特征是,步驟(1-4)包括如下步驟:
利用如下公式將(xl,yl)還原為原始圖像坐標(xo,yo):
設定檢測結果i的子圖的中心位置為(xoi,yoi),檢測結果j的子圖的中心位置為(xoj,yoj);
若T2為融合閾值;
則通過修改檢測結果i的子圖的中心坐標將檢測結果i和檢測結果j融合:
將檢測結果j從結果列表中刪除;
當結果列表中的檢測結果已無可融合的檢測結果時,輸出結果列表中的各個檢測結果的中心坐標,將各個中心坐標作為當前時刻人臉檢測的最終結果。
該專利技術資料僅供研究查看技術是否侵權等信息,商用須獲得專利權人授權。該專利全部權利屬于杭州智諾科技股份有限公司,未經杭州智諾科技股份有限公司許可,擅自商用是侵權行為。如果您想購買此專利、獲得商業授權和技術合作,請聯系【客服】
本文鏈接:http://www.szxzyx.cn/pat/books/201810388775.9/1.html,轉載請聲明來源鉆瓜專利網。





